What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Dallas to Perth?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Dallas to Perth cl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Dallas to Perth, Monday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Thursday is the most expensive. Flying from Perth back to Dallas, the best deals are generally found on Thursday, with Saturday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Dallas to Perth?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Dallas to Perth,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Dallas to Perth is May, where tickets cost $1,431 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,972 and $2,765 respectively.
